




Israel’s ruling coalition announced on Sunday that the general elections for the Knesset, the country’s parliament, will be held as originally scheduled on Oct 27 and will not be brought forward, Israel’s state-owned Kan TV News reported.
According to Israeli law, general elections for parliament are supposed to be held every four years.
